Overview Lurasid 80mg Tablet

Lurasid 80mg tablets effectively manage schizophrenia, a debilitating mental illness characterized by distorted perceptions (hallucinations and delusions) and impaired cognitive function. This medication also treats depressive episodes, mania, and bipolar disorder. Administer Lurasid 80mg with food, consistently at the same time daily for optimal blood levels. Follow your physician's prescribed dosage and duration; if a dose is missed, take it immediately upon recollection. Abrupt cessation is discouraged; consult your doctor before discontinuing treatment to avoid symptom exacerbation.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, dry mouth, and sleep disturbances (insomnia). Drowsiness and dizziness are also possible; avoid activities requiring alertness until the medication's effects are known. Report any unusual mood shifts, worsening depression, or suicidal ideation to your doctor. Weight gain is a potential side effect, mitigated by a balanced diet and regular exercise. While rare, serious adverse reactions such as hyperglycemia (high blood sugar) or convulsions warrant immediate medical attention.

Common Side effects of Lurasid 80mg Tablet:

  • Nausea
  • Vomiting
  • Weight gain
  • Sleepiness
  • Dryness in mouth
  • Indigestion
  • Anxiety
  • Stomach discomfort
  • Upper abdominal pain
  • Insomnia (difficulty in sleeping)
  • Increased saliva production

How to use Lurasid 80mg Tablet:

Consume this medication precisely as directed by your physician, adhering to the prescribed dosage and treatment length.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Lurasid 80mg tablets should be administered with a meal.

How Lurasid 80mg Tablet works:

Lurasid 80mg tablets alter the activity of specific neurotransmitters in the brain, thereby influencing cognitive processes.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Combining Lurasid 80mg Tablet and alcohol is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Pregnant women may experience adverse effects from Lurasid 80mg Tablets.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the risks and advantages before prescribing this medication. Seek medical advice before using Lurasid 80mg Tablets during pregnancy.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Breastfeeding while taking Lurasid 80mg tablets is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king an 80mg Lurasid t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Refrain from driving if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with impaired kidney function should exercise caution when using 80mg Lurasid tablets. A modified dosage of Lurasid 80mg tablets may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Lurasid 80m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take Lurasid 80mg Tablet :

Should you forget a dose of your Lurasid 80mg Tablet,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Lurasid 80mg Tablet

Avoid Lurasid 80mg Tablets during pregnancy unless your doctor prescribes them. Post-birth, your baby will require close monitoring, as Lurasid 80mg Tablet use during the pregnancy's final trimester may cause neonatal shaking, sleepiness, agitation, breathing difficulties, feeding problems, and muscle stiffness or weakness.
Lurasid 80mg Tablets can raise blood sugar in diabetic patients and those at risk. It may also lower white blood cell counts and increase prolactin, cholesterol, and triglyceride levels. Consequently, your doctor may order blood tests to monitor these levels during treatment.
To minimize its bitter taste, swallow Lurasid 80mg tablets whole with water. Taking them with or immediately after meals improves absorption and effectiveness. For best results, take your tablet at the same time each day.
Lurasid 80mg Tablets may cause weight gain in some users, but not all. Consult your doctor or a registered dietitian if this occurs. A balanced diet and regular exercise can aid in weight management.
Lurasid 80mg tablets may require several days or weeks before symptom improvement is noticeable. Patients are closely monitored throughout this period.
Avoid alcohol and grapefruit juice while taking Lurasid 80mg tablets; both can cause serious adverse reactions or interfere with the medication's effectiveness.
In elderly patients with dementia-related psychosis (confusion, memory loss, or disorientation), Lurasid 80mg Tablets may increase the risk of death. Suicidal thoughts or behavior may occur in some children, teenagers, and young adults during the initial months of treatment or dose adjustments.
Lurasid 80mg Tablets can cause dizziness, drowsiness, and visual disturbances. Avoid driving or operating machinery if you experience these side effects.
